    Hey anne,

    If Humira is what you are talking about, which i believe you are because adalimumab is the doctor term for it, then I am here to tell ya it is a miracle drug. I dealt with HS ever since I was 11, I am now 21. However, before starting Humira last year I had at least one flare up every year since 11, multiple surgeries and injections, as well as other attempted treatments. Nothing has worked better than Humira. *Knock on wood* This has been the first whole year that I have not had one flare up and I have had very minimal side effects. I get stuffy noses pretty commonly due to the drug downing your immune system but that can be the only one I can think of. I hope this helps, I highly recommend if you really want to tackle the nasty HS!
